About the Webinar: Supervision has long been a cornerstone of becoming an LMFT. In today's world, supervision often takes place virtually. This webinar will focus on navigating supervision in the online space. Topics will include the benefits and pitfalls of online supervision, along with other aspects beneficial for attendees offering virtual supervision.
